Why Structure Type Matters in house Planning

The structure type of your house affects not only the style but also the stability, insulation, and adaptability of your design. Browse House Plan Types by Structure

  • Single-story houses for simplified living and easy accessibility

  • 2 story house plans for maximizing space on narrow lots

  • Split-level houses that adapt to sloped terrains

  • Raised or pier and beam structures for flood-prone or coastal regions

  • Multi-family structure plans for investment or shared living

  • Barndominium plans that merge modern living with barn-style architecture
